iMath is a math-fact fluency world built for this classroom: students earn a daily "Green Light" by practicing facts inside seven mini-games, an adaptive engine tracks true fluency (speed of recall, not just accuracy โ€” with each child's typing speed calibrated out), and across the term students design their own games on paper, see them built, and iterate like real designers.

4

Finger warm-up

~30 seconds

The child types five numbers as fast as they can. The app measures milliseconds per digit and stores that as their personal typing baseline.

Why it matters: fluency here means speed of recall, so the engine has to know how much of a child's answer time was thumbs and how much was thinking. Every later "was that fast?" judgement adds their own typing overhead back in โ€” a slow typist is never mistaken for a slow mathematician.

A 'Finger warm-up!' modal over the island showing a large number 7 above an on-screen number keypad.
"Type the numbers as fast as you can. This teaches the island your speed!"
5

The skills assessment

~2 minutes ยท once

The placement test is a carnival high striker โ€” "Test Your Strengths." Each swing of the mallet is one math fact; ringing the bell means the child has cleared a skill band. It searches five bands, and it does not march up them in order:

Two quick correct answers clear a band and the test jumps upward; two misses drop it back down. It is a binary search, capped at fifteen questions, so most students finish in about two minutes regardless of level.

Two design promises to tell your class: one slow-but-correct answer never counts against them โ€” a distracted moment is not evidence. And "don't know โ€” skip" is scored exactly like a wrong answer, no worse, so there is nothing to gain by guessing and nothing to fear in skipping.

The Test Your Strengths high striker mid-assessment: a banner reads 'ROUND 3 ยท Times tables โ€” 0s, 1s, 2s and 10s', with the problem 100 รท 10 = ? above a keypad and a 'don't know โ€” skip' link.
The round banner names the band out loud, so the child can see the tower getting harder rather than feeling randomly punished.
6

The placement result

the pay-off

Clearing a band credits every fact underneath it. A strong student never grinds 1+1, and a student who is still shaky on their tables never opens the app on 7ร—8.

Credited is not mastered. Everything the assessment credits starts as practicing โ€” it still has to be answered quickly, several times, inside the games before the engine calls it fluent. Placement sets the starting line, not the grade.

A results card reading 'You rang the bell!', '405 facts already glowing in your power grid', and 'You're starting at: Times tables โ€” 3s, 4s and 5s!'
Roughly two minutes of questions, and the child is placed at their own frontier.
7

The island

home base

A carnival midway the student walks around with arrow keys, WASD, or by tapping the ground. Booths are the games; Axel's School is one-on-one coaching on a fact family they keep missing; the tower is always there for a re-test.

Sky Hopper and Critter Garden are open on day one. The other five booths are padlocked and cost a key โ€” which is where the daily goal comes in.

An isometric carnival island with bunting, trees and booths labelled Penalty Hero, Meadow Gallop, Comet Dash, Home Run Derby, Touchdown Drive, Critter Garden, Token Store, Sky Hopper and Axel's School, most showing padlocks.
Day one: two booths open, five padlocked, one green cube to walk around in.

๐ŸŸข Green Light is the daily goal: answer a target number of different facts correctly in a day. The target is 40 โ€” but it is capped at how many facts the student actually has in play, so a day-one child with ten facts can still win the day. Hitting it extends their goal-day streak.

๐Ÿ—๏ธ Keys come from Green Light days โ€” one key per streak day โ€” and one key opens any booth the student chooses. Booths are earned, never bought, and never gated behind a fixed order.

8

Sky Hopper

the tense one

Three platforms are live at once, each labelled with a fact. Answer one and the frog hops up to it. A wall of fog rises from below the whole time; if it catches you, the climb ends.

The loss condition is announced before the game starts, and the card closes with the promise that makes the whole thing safe: "If the fog catches you, the climb ends โ€” but everything you learn is saved." No lives, no strikes, no lost progress.

Sky Hopper's start card: 'โ˜๏ธ The fog is chasing you! Answer facts to hop higher and stay above it. If the fog catches you, the climb ends โ€” but everything you learn is saved.' with a GO! button. Sky Hopper in play: a green frog on a platform labelled 100 รท 10, with platforms 13 โˆ’ 8, 15 โˆ’ 9 and 4 + 9 above, an altitude of 81m, and a 'fog 104m below' marker.
Top: the telegraph. Bottom: the climb, with the fog distance always visible at the bottom edge.
9

Critter Garden

the calm one

No timer, no chase. Every correct answer grows a flower, and flowers bring visitors: Shelly the snail at 4, Dot the ladybug at 8, Flit the butterfly at 12, Buzz at 16, and Plume at 20 โ€” which throws the Garden Party.

The Garden Party tracker is the point: a child who finds Sky Hopper stressful gets the identical fluency engine wrapped in something that only ever accumulates. Every classroom needs both temperaments available.

Critter Garden: a pixel-art meadow of flowers with a snail and a ladybug, the problem 13 โˆ’ 4 = ?, and a 'Garden Party 11 / 20' tracker showing guest pips and 'next guest: Flit at 12'.
The Garden Party tracker shows exactly who arrives next and how many flowers away they are.
10

Your view

/dashboard.html

One tab per student, five summary numbers, and a fact family map โ€” one cell per family, colored fluent / practicing / learning / not started / needs help. Below it, "Needs a hand" lists the families a student has missed three times running, each with the strategy hint to try one-on-one.

Per-student controls sit at the bottom: switch their fact set (full ladder, addโ€“subtract only, multiplyโ€“divide only), unlock all games, reset progress, or remove the student entirely.

The iMath Teacher View: roster tabs, summary tiles reading 0% fluent, 0/567 facts mastered, Green Light 6/40, 0 goal-day streak, 12 tokens, and a 13x13 fact family map with yellow, blue and grey cells.
This student has just been placed: hundreds of facts credited as practicing (yellow), nothing yet proven fluent, and the 6sโ€“12s tables still untouched (grey).

The Game Designer Program 6 phases

Alongside the daily fluency work, every student designs a game of their own on paper โ€” and we build it. The packet is six phases; phases 3 and 4 repeat as often as you like.

๐Ÿ’กPhase 1My Game Idea 3 sheets: describe it โ†’ draw your hero โ†’ write the paragraph with connecting words.
๐Ÿ”Phase 2Game Loops 3 sheets: learn what a loop is โ†’ be a detective on a game you love โ†’ design your own loop, then name it.
๐ŸŽฎPhase 3Play It & Update It Their game is on the island. Too easy / just right / too tricky, ONE change, a prediction.
๐Ÿ‘€Phase 4Friend Playtest Watch a classmate play โ€” silently โ€” then revise from what you saw, not what you hoped.
๐ŸŽคPhase 5Pitch & Present An opinion-writing pitch plus a one-minute presentation of the game and its update story.
โž•Phase 6 ยท optionalMath Brainstorm Teacher's choice. An idea bank โ€” arrays, quadrilaterals, equal groups, symmetry โ€” for putting math inside their own game.

โŸณ Phases 3 and 4 are the iteration loop โ€” repeat them and designers collect versions (v2, v3โ€ฆ).

Sheets are one focused task each, sized for large 3rd-grade handwriting, with scan-anchor marks so completed packets can be photographed and read back automatically. Nothing assumes a game has coins. Phases 2โ€“4 work unchanged for a cardboard-arcade unit โ€” same design loop, cardboard instead of pixels.

3rd-grade standards it exercises labels & titles

StandardTitle (abridged)Where it shows up
3.OA.C.7Fluently multiply and divide within 100; know products from memoryThe daily games themselves โ€” the core fluency engine (add/sub facts likewise for students assigned them)
3.OA.A.1 ยท A.3Interpret products; solve problems with equal groups and arraysPhase 6 Math Brainstorm: planning collectibles as an array or as equal groups
3.OA.D.9Identify and explain arithmetic patternsPhase 6 Math Brainstorm: writing a pattern rule for their own game ("every 4th coinโ€ฆ")
3.G.A.1Categories of shapes; recognize and draw quadrilateralsPhase 6 Math Brainstorm: quadrilateral hunt in their own game art
RI.3.3 ยท RI.3.8Describe a sequence of steps; connect sentences with first/second/thirdPhase 2: the loop is a sequence โ€” the detective sheet and their own goal โ†’ action โ†’ tricky part
W.3.1Opinion pieces: point of view, reasons, linking words, conclusionPhase 5 pitch ("You should play my game becauseโ€ฆ alsoโ€ฆ finallyโ€ฆ")
W.3.2Informative/explanatory writing with illustrationsPhase 1 paragraph, with the hero drawing as the illustration
L.3.1 ยท L.3.2 ยท L.3.3aGrammar, capitalization/punctuation/spelling, word choice for effectEvery written field; title capitalization; the feelings word bank
SL.3.1 ยท SL.3.4Collaborative discussion; report with facts and details, clear pacePhase 4 playtest conversation; the Phase 5 one-minute pitch
CA NGSS 3-5-ETS1-1Define a design problem with criteria and constraintsPhase 2: naming the goal, the action, and what makes the game tricky
CA NGSS 3-5-ETS1-3Carry out fair tests and use results to improve a designPhases 3 & 4 update cards โ€” observe, change one variable, predict, retest
